- [ ] Step 7: Archive cold storage buckets (Glacierline tier). Confirm both ceremony witnesses are present, verify bucket manifests match the Oxbow ledger, then seal the archive key shares. Plugin authors may observe but not handle shares. Once sealed, the archive index itself is encrypted and can only be reopened with the passphrase below.

vault phrase of badup-hahig = tamael-aldael-kelmir-istael-fenok-istwyn-tamius-jorath-oliion

Subject: Key rotation for InvoiceForge renderer

Welcome, new folks. Every quarter we rotate the credential the Pellworth PDF invoice renderer uses to call our internal asset service, Vaultline. The old key stops working Friday at noon. Update your local .env and the staging config before then, and verify a test invoice renders with the new embedded fonts. For convenience, the freshly issued key is included here.

app token of bagef-bageg = kto11_vuwA0uhrEMg

Ticket: Missed Pick-up — Sample Shipment to Verlane Labs

The scheduled morning collection of the three chilled sample crates for Verlane Labs did not occur; the courier from Drossfield Transit never arrived at dock B. The crates remain in cold storage and are stable for another 36 hours, so a re-run tomorrow is acceptable. Please confirm the crates are resealed and the temperature logs attached before release. The replacement courier will require the hand-over instruction noted below.

courier memo of fadug-tajop: the gorir sorael courier leaves the istys ledger at gate 1509 under passcode 497843

The Tallowgate payment service uses idempotency keys to guarantee that retried charge requests never double-bill a customer. Each environment (sandbox, staging, production) keeps its own key store with a separate retention window, so a key accepted in sandbox will not be recognized in production. When investigating a duplicate-charge report, always confirm which environment the request hit and whether the key had expired. Each environment's key-handling behavior is controlled by the following configuration values.

service settings:
[casax]
port = 6379
team = rusir
host = casax.zemvarhq.corp
region = outer-4
access_code = ac_9808ce
timeout_ms = 1500